Jeonju Bibimbap Festival

The Jeonju Bibimbap Festival (Korean전주 비빔밥 축제) is an annual Korean food festival that takes place in the Jeonju Hanok Village in South Korea. It centers on a regional variety of the popular Korean dish bibimbap. The festival has been celebrated since 2007.[1]

Overview edit

The festival usually takes place during the month of October every year. It showcases the most iconic dish of the region, bibimbap, and a favorite among tourists.[2] Visitors to the festival can participate in cooking competitions, sample local recipes, and learn how to cook traditional bibimbap. They can also participate in folk games, enjoy concerts, and visit a night market.[3][1]

The festival has been reported to draw 150,000 citizens and tourists.[4] It was cancelled in 2020 due to the COVID-19 pandemic. However, in 2021, the festival was held over four-weeks under the title "World Bibim Week" ("월드 비빔위크").[5]

In 2022, the festival was held offline from the 6th to the 10th of October.[6]
